Wet High Intensity Magnetic Separation

The high operating cost of the energy consumed in roasting is partially compensated by reduced grinding costs and by energy returned in the conversion of magnetite to hematite during pellet induration. The capital cost, which is also high, would be reduced if roasted ore were processed in an existing magnetic separation plant.

Separation characteristics of dry high-intensity drum magnetic …

The dominant operating parameters of a given DHIDMS separator are feed particle size and drum rotation speed. It is noted that the separation cutter is another dominant parameter affecting the DHIDMS performance, and it depends on such factors as magnetic induction, feed particle size and drum rotation speed.

Intensity Magnetic Separator

As shown in Figure 13.2, minerals with ferromagnetic properties have high susceptibility at low applied field strengths and can therefore be concentrated in low intensity (<~0.3 T) magnetic separators. For low-intensity drum separators (Figure 13.11) used in the iron ore industry, the standard field, for a separator with ferrite-based magnets, is 0.12 T at …
